> While tackling bug 699, it became clear to me that irq balancing is the cause
> of the performance problems I, and all people using the SMP kernel Mandrake
> 9.1 ships, are dealing with. I got the problems with 2.5.69 too. After
> disabling irq balancing, the system is remarkably faster, and much more
> responsive.
>
> For those interested in the issue, please look at bug 699.

Could you test out this patch from Keith Mannthey if you're having trouble?
It makes irq balance a config option, which makes it easier to disable.
Various people have requested it, but I don't have a box to test it on ;-(
Pulled out of -mjb tree, but should go onto mainline easily.
